What Are the New UK Recycling Rules for Businesses?
The UK government continues to increase the focus on improving recycling rates and reducing unnecessary landfill waste.
New recycling requirements are expected to place greater emphasis on:
- Waste separation
- Recycling collection systems
- Responsible disposal routes
- Commercial waste compliance
- Food waste separation for some businesses
Many businesses may need to review how waste is stored, separated and collected depending on the type of waste they produce.

Why Waste Separation Is Becoming More Important
Separating recyclable materials helps reduce landfill waste and improves recycling recovery rates.
Materials commonly separated for recycling include:
- Cardboard
- Plastic
- Metal
- Food waste
- Paper
- Wood
- Green waste
Working with licensed waste carriers and authorised transfer stations helps ensure waste is handled responsibly and processed through the correct recycling and recovery systems.

How Businesses Can Prepare
Businesses can begin preparing for changing recycling requirements by:
- Reviewing current waste collection arrangements
- Improving waste separation
- Using licensed waste carriers
- Reducing mixed waste contamination
- Ensuring waste is disposed of responsibly
Clear waste collection systems can also help businesses improve efficiency and reduce unnecessary disposal issues.
